Col. Elias Earle Historic District

It encompasses 74 contributing buildings in a middle-class neighborhood of Greenville.

The district was originally part of the estate of Colonel Elias Earle, a prominent early-19th century Greenville citizen.

The Earle St. Baptist Church is located in the district.

[2][3] It was added to the National Register of Historic Places in 1982.
